Willmeng Construction celebrated the completion of a tenant improvement project for United Foods International. The 129,172-square-foot shell building has been transformed into a food preparation and packaging facility for the global firm. The completion of this facility was celebrated with a ribbon-cutting event on May 7. The event underscored the collaborative effort required to first attract major international companies and then deliver the facilities they need to succeed. UFI, a U.S. affiliate of the Japan-based Senba Group, is a global company with affiliated production sites across Asia. Willmeng Completes First New Mesa Public Library in 30 Years
Willmeng Construction completed the new Mesa Gateway Library, the first public library to be built in the city in 30 years. The project, located in the heart of the Eastmark Great Park, is a community centerpiece designed to serve its users for generations to come. Willmeng led the construction of the 28,272-square-foot facility, which was designed by architecture firm Richärd Kennedy Architects. The library is organized around an open market concept unified by a soaring, folded roof. Willmeng Names Michelle Rousseau Director of Trade Relations
Michelle Rousseau has been hired as director of trade relations at Willmeng Construction. This newly created director-level position is designed to deepen relationships with key trade partners and enhance communication across the firm’s growing market sectors. Rousseau’s role was created to proactively grow the base of specialized subcontractor firms to serve expanded market sectors. This position is unique to general contractors and is specifically designed to drive deeper partnerships and mutually leverage the strengths of the companies. ViaWest Group, Willmeng Begin Work on Transformative ReDiscover Logistics Park
ViaWest Group, in partnership with Barings and Willmeng Construction, has officially broken ground on ReDiscover Logistics Park, an 808,448-square-foot Class A industrial development in Phoenix’s Deer Valley submarket. Work is now underway on one of the most strategically positioned industrial parks in Greater Phoenix, with delivery anticipated in Q1 2027. ReDiscover Logistics Park will revitalize the 43.5 acre site formerly known as Deer Valley Innovation Park. The project is designed by Butler Design Group, with Kimley-Horn serving as civil engineer. Willmeng Completes McCormick-Stillman Railroad Park Improvements in Scottsdale
Willmeng Construction hosted a grand re-opening event to mark the successful completion of significant renovations at the McCormick-Stillman Railroad Park in Scottsdale. The extensive renovation aimed to enhance recreational offerings and boost park attendance. A centerpiece of the renovation is the replacement of the former Bunkhouse and Clock Tower with a new 7,500-square-foot structure known as the Roundhouse. The modern facility now features a signature railroad-themed indoor play structure, public restrooms, offices, conference rooms and support spaces.
